What Does Elderly Care in Croydon Involve?

Elderly care is more than just medical assistance. It's about maintaining dignity, routine, and happiness in everyday lifewhether thats through practical help or emotional companionship.

Types of Care Options Available

In Croydon, families can choose from a wide variety of senior care services, including:

  • In-home care (also called domiciliary care)

  • Live-in care for constant supervision

  • Residential care homes

  • Respite care for families who need a break

  • Specialist dementia or Alzheimers care

Each option is designed to meet a persons unique health, social, and emotional needs.

Support for Older Adults with Varying Needs

From light daily assistance to full-time care, services may include:

  • Mobility support

  • Help with meals, hygiene, and medication

  • Housekeeping and errands

  • Monitoring chronic conditions

  • Emotional support and companionship

For example, an older adult whos mostly independent may benefit from aged care at home in Croydon with just a couple of visits a week. Others with mobility or memory issues might require 24/7 supervision or specialist care.

Residential and Home Care for Seniors in Croydon

Both residential homes and home care services have their place. The right choice depends on health, lifestyle, and personal preference.

Comparing Home Care vs Residential Homes

Factor

In-Home Care

Residential Care

Comfort

Stay in familiar surroundings

Must adjust to communal environment

Cost

Flexible; pay-as-you-go

Often expensive, flat monthly rates

Customization

Fully tailored to individual needs

More standardized care

Social Interaction

Limited unless arranged separately

Built-in community of residents

Family Access

Unlimited

Often regulated visiting hours

While residential care might be the better choice for someone with advanced medical needs, in-home care offers a better experience for many seniors who value their independence.
